What You’ll Need
Gather these ingredients to create your delicious wraps:
For the Chicken Mixture
- 1 lb ground chicken
- 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tablespoon ginger, minced
- 1/4 cup soy sauce
- 2 tablespoons hoisin sauce
- 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
- 1/2 cup water chestnuts, diced
For Serving
- 2 green onions, sliced
- 1 head of lettuce (iceberg or butter lettuce)

Substitutions & Swaps
- Ground turkey works well instead of chicken.
- Use coconut aminos for a soy-free option.
- Shredded carrots add extra crunch and sweetness.
- Romaine can serve as an alternative to iceberg lettuce.
How to Make It
Follow these simple steps for a delicious dinner.
Heat the Oil
Heat oil in a skillet over medium heat until shimmering.
Sauté the Aromatics
Add garlic and ginger, sauté for 1 minute until fragrant.
Cook the Chicken
Add ground chicken and cook until browned, breaking it apart with a spatula.
Stir in the Sauces
Stir in soy sauce, hoisin sauce, rice vinegar, and water chestnuts until well combined.
Finish Cooking
Cook for an additional 5 minutes, allowing the mixture to thicken slightly.
Serve
Serve the mixture in lettuce leaves topped with green onions for crunch.
How to Store It
Fridge: store in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
Freezer: no, the texture will change.
Reheat: in a skillet over medium heat for 5-7 minutes.
